New Registry Fees from January 1, 2023

On August 12, 2022, the British Virgin Island (BVI) government enacted the BVI Business Companies (Amendment) Act, 2022 (the “BVI Amendment Act 2022”), which contains significant changes to the BVI companies’ regime.
Similar to the Economic Substance Reporting requirement imposed on BVI companies in 2019, the new amendments are designed to comply with evolving international standards on transparency and the fight against financial crimes.
The new amendments take effect on January 1, 2023.

The most notable changes are as follows:

  • The incorporation fee for a standard company authorized to issue up to 50,000 shares increases from $500to $550 and, for a company authorized to issue more than 50,000 shares from, $1,200 to $1,350.
  • Registration or annual renewal of a foreign company carrying on business in the BVI, fee increases from $500 to $550.
  • Most other filing fees and fees for issue of certificates by the Registry have been increased.
